The Influence of the Environment on the Distribution of Vegetation Communities in Rawdhat Salasil, Saudi Arabia |

Abstract:
Ecological and botanical survey were conducted on Rawdhat Salasil, Al-Qassim region, Saudi Arabia. The survey also includes the study of the plant communities in the study area by sampling the associated species in each community using the List Count Quadrant method to study the density, frequency, and plant cover. The present study has shown an account of the under-mentioned five different communities: Haloxylon persicum Bunge ex Boiss. community is a dominant perennial shrub with an importance value of 47.88%. 20 associated species represent this community. The chemical analysis of the soil of this plant habitat exhibits more alkalinity with low salinity. Tamarix nilotica Ehrenb. community is a perennial shrub with an importance value of 60.48%. 14 associated species represent this community. The chemical analysis of the soil of this plant habitat demonstrates richness in alkalis with high salinity. Salsola imbricate Forssk. community is a perennial herb with an importance value of 60.18%. 17 associated species represent this community. The chemical analysis of the soil of this plant habitat exhibits richness in alkalis with low salinity. Panicum turgidum Forssk. is a perennial herb with an importance value of 65.1%. 11 associated species represent this community. The chemical analysis of the soil of this plant habitat exhibits richness in alkalis and an absence of salinity. Pulicaria undulate L. community is predominantly an annual shrub with an importance value of 91.79%. 16 species represent this community. The chemical analysis of the soil of this plant habitat exhibits richness in alkalis and an absence of salinity.
